Islamabad: Rain with wind-thundershower is expected in Balochistan, Sindh, Kashmir, Punjab, Khyber Pakhtunkhwa and Gilgit-Baltistan during the next 12 hours.
Heavy falls are also likely at few places in Kashmir, South Punjab and eastern Balochistan during the period.
Temperature of some major cities recorded this morning:
Islamabad twenty-six degree centigrade, Lahore twenty-seven, Karachi and Peshawar twenty-eight, Quetta and Gilgit twenty-one, Murree seventeen and Muzaffarabad twenty-four degree centigrade.
According to Met office forecast for Indian Illegally Occupied Jammu and Kashmir, cloudy weather with chances of rain and wind/thundershower is expected in Srinagar, partly cloudy weather with chances of rain-wind/thundershower (with few heavy falls) in Jammu, partly cloudy weather with chances of rain-wind/thundershower in Leh while cloudy weather with chances of rain-wind/thundershower in Pulwama, Anantnag, Shopian and Baramulla.
Temperature recorded this morning:
Srinagar and Pulwama twenty-one degree centigrade, Jammu twenty-six, Leh Sixteen, Anantnag twenty, Shopian nineteen and Baramulla eight degree centigrade.
